Personalized Learning Path: The End of “One Size Fits All”

One of the primary ways EdTech is bridging the gap is through Adaptive Learning Technology. These platforms use AI to analyze a student’s strengths and weaknesses in real-time. If a student struggles with algebraic equations, the system doesn’t just give them a failing grade; it pivots, offering foundational videos and practice problems to address the root misunderstanding.

Data-Driven Insights: Predicting Failure Before it Happens

Predictive analytics is perhaps the most “silent” yet powerful tool in the EdTech arsenal of 2026. Schools are now using “Early Warning Systems” (EWS) that track engagement metrics—how long a student spends on a reading, their performance on micro-quizzes, and even the sentiment of their forum posts.

  • Source: A 2025 study by the Oxford Internet Institute found that AI-driven early intervention reduced course dropout rates by 18% in hybrid learning environments.

By identifying “at-risk” students weeks before a midterm exam, educators can provide targeted interventions, effectively closing the gap before it widens into a failing grade.

Q4: Can EdTech help students with learning disabilities? 

Absolutely. 2026 EdTech includes built-in tools for neurodivergent learners, such as speech-to-text, dyslexia-friendly fonts, and AI that adjusts content density for those with ADHD.
